**Alert: ScanDecodeMismatch — Crateline scanner integration.** The Brindlewarehouse handhelds are reporting a 4% mismatch between decoded barcodes and catalog SKUs after yesterday's merge of the symbology-normalization change. The suspect commit touches the checksum-stripping logic in the Crateline adapter. Please review the diff with attention to GS1 prefix handling before approving a revert or a forward fix. The failing payloads, comparison dashboards, and reviewer notes are collected on the internal page below.

wiki page, hahif-hahif: https://argocd.kelvisys.corp/browse/board/settings/pages/1442e0b1065d83f1

FACILITIES TICKET — Hollowpine Campus, Building C
Subject: Holiday-period opening hours (night shift)

From 24 December through 2 January, the main atrium doors at Hollowpine will lock at 19:00 instead of 22:00. Night shift staff should enter via the east service corridor only, as the lobby turnstiles will be powered down for maintenance. Please check that the loading dock shutter is fully closed before 23:30 each night, since security patrols are reduced over the break. The corridor reader requires the temporary night-shift pass code below.

staff pass of kawip-hawef = bdg-QLP-2

Subject: Quickstore 4.2 — bloom filter now fronts the KV layer

Plugin authors: starting with this release, Quickstore places a bloom filter ahead of the key-value store. Negative lookups return faster; false positives fall through safely. No API changes are required on your side. Verify your plugin against the staging build referenced below.

session token of fahif-tadup = htk3_9c7

**Ticket PBK-412: Breaker stuck open against Harborline API**

The Tidewatch circuit breaker wrapping the upstream Harborline quotes API is latching open after a single timeout instead of honoring the five-failure threshold. On-call: check the half-open probe interval config before restarting anything, and capture breaker state metrics first. Reproduced reliably on the staging build referenced below.

trace token, fafog-kageg: htk4_98e6